Ledbury-based goalkeeper Skyers bids for GB Blind Football Paralympic place

Ledbury’S Lewis Skyers has boosted his claim for a place in the Great Britain Blind football team’s Paralympic squad.

The Ledbury-based sighted goalkeeper made several outstanding saves as a second-half substitute against European Champions France in last Saturday’s goalless international in Hereford.

He made a four vital saves, including a diving stop in the dying minutes, as Tony Larkin’s GB team entertained the 257-strong crowd at thePoint4.

GB controlled the first period and should have been several goals up at the break after Dan English and Dave Clarke missed penalties.

Skipper Clarke was also unlucky in the first half when his shot crashed against a post.
